Erik ten Hag is ready to give another chance to Marcus Rashford and Jess Lingard. This is the news of the prestigious "The Sun", according to which the Dutchman does not want the two strikers to leave in the summer, which will be the moment when the coach will take over the leadership of United.
Rashford has received the guarantee of Erik ten Hag, who has promised the Englishman that he will be active next season. During this year, Marcus was left out of the English national team by coach Southgate, a decision which was justified given the poor form of the striker. So far the United player has scored only 5 goals in 32 appearances this season. Based on this, interim coach Ralf Rangnick, has given more minutes of activation to Jadon Sancho and Anthony Elanga.
Meanwhile Jess Lingard is also expecting a positive signal from Ten Hag, and does not want to leave in a hurry in the summer. The striker played on loan at West Ham, where he scored 9 goals and 5 assists in 16 appearances with the club. But since returning to United, he has hardly been active with the Red Devils.
